"Search and See" Section.
Romans x.--
(1) How does faith come?
(2) How is confessing the Lord related to believing?
(3) What is the result of faith?
Ephesians ii. 1-10-- (1) Can salvation by grace through faith be earned?
(2) What is it that we cannot do in order to be saved
and yet we should do after we are saved?
Hebrews xi. 1-31-- (1) In what way is faith the "substance" of things hoped for?
(2) Can you give another meaning for the words "By faith"
which come in connection with the people in this chapter?
(3) What did this faith do for them and what will it do for us?
Habakkuk i., ii., iii.-- (1) Is prayer always answered at once? (i.).
(2) What are we to do in (ii.), and what will help us to do this?
(3) If we have faith in the Lord, what can we do although
things go wrong around us? (iii.).
Verses to memorize (one each week):
Rom. x. 17; Eph. ii. 8; Heb. xi. 1; Hab. ii. 3.
